I have the RTV 900 and I find that it has plenty of power for climbing hills, pulling up small trees even once had to use it to pull start a 750 JD tractor. It had no trouble dragging it with the wheels sliding in Med range. It doesnt have a lot of power in High gear but in Low and Med it works fine. If when climbing a hill and you need more power, just back off the throttle and it will climb better at least on my model. Mine is a 2005 model and I suppose some mods have been done as stated. I like the braking but it does need some getting used to. Mine is a bit hard to shift if you stop on an incline if you dont use the knob to release the pressure on they hydraulics which I understand that issue is now fixed. It is a bit heavy and tends to bog a lot in soft soil, but I havent gotten it stuck yet ( I have the ATV tires on mine) but I dont think the HDWS tires would go well in mud or snow so consider that when purchasing. I think it has the best hydraulics for the dump bed in the industry, however I think the dump bed sides could ust a little better stiffening as mine tend to rattle a bit and require some adjusting occassionally to keep them tight against the lock ( just a hard push on the side to flex them back)

We have a farmers market and use the Kubota 900 and 1100 to Plow, Seed and harvest pumpkins, corn and tomatoes. We also use it to plow snow, when there is snow. We have Kubota 900 and 1100 and a Cushman 1600. We also have had the Bobcat Toolcat and the Toro workman out to the farm for demos.

I'm not going to recommend a specific make, you can probably tell which one I prefer. However, I would strongly recommend hydraulics on whatever machine you choose. Diesel is nice as well. The hydraulics really open up the machines to multiple uses.
